import RYLR896Py
from _thread import *
import threading
import json
import requests
import pynmea2
from dotenv import load_dotenv
load_dotenv()
import os
# 1. Setup serial connection
lora = RYLR896Py.RYLR896("/dev/ttyS0", 115200)
lora.SetRFParamsLessThan3KM()
lora.SetAESPassword("FABC0002EEDCAA90FABC0002EEDCAA90")
def dataHandler(data):
# Split data on '|' separator character
dataSplit = data["message"].split("|")
dataToSend = {}
dataToSend["drone_id"] = dataSplit[0]
dataToSend["GPRMC"] = dataSplit[1]
dataToSend["gps_data"] = {}
try:
gprmc_nmea2 = pynmea2.parse(dataToSend["GPRMC"])
dataToSend["gps_data"]["status"] = gprmc_nmea2.status
dataToSend["gps_data"]["timestamp"] = str(gprmc_nmea2.timestamp)
dataToSend["gps_data"]["datestamp"] = str(gprmc_nmea2.datestamp)
dataToSend["gps_data"]["longitude"] = str(gprmc_nmea2.longitude)
dataToSend["gps_data"]["longitude_minutes"] = str(gprmc_nmea2.longitude_minutes)
dataToSend["gps_data"]["longitude_seconds"] = str(gprmc_nmea2.longitude_seconds)
dataToSend["gps_data"]["latitude"] = str(gprmc_nmea2.latitude)
dataToSend["gps_data"]["latitude_minutes"] = str(gprmc_nmea2.latitude_minutes)
dataToSend["gps_data"]["latitude_seconds"] = str(gprmc_nmea2.latitude_seconds)
except Exception as e:
print(e)
print(dataToSend["gps_data"])
dataToSend["sensorReadings"] = {}
for sensorReading in dataSplit[2:]:
name = sensorReading.split("=")[0]
reading = sensorReading.split("=")[1]
dataToSend["sensorReadings"][name] = reading
jsonData = json.dumps(dataToSend)
print(jsonData)
url = os.getenv("BACKEND_LOG_ENDPOINT")
try:
req = requests.post(url, json = dataToSend)
print(req.text)
except Exception as e:
print(e)
# 2. Listen for data
while True:
data = lora.Receive()
if data is not None:
# On data:
# a. Check if valid
# b. Parse into object
# c. Prepare server request
# d. Send request to REST API
start_new_thread(dataHandler, (data,))
